About Converting Short tons per Cubic yard to Drams per Milliliter

Short ton per Cubic yard and Dram per Milliliter both measure density — mass per unit volume — a property used to identify materials, check manufacturing quality, and predict whether something floats or sinks. As a fixed reference point, water has a density of exactly 1000 kg/m³ (1 g/cm³, 1 g/mL) at its temperature of maximum density, which is why many density figures in science and engineering are quoted relative to water. Both are mass per volume density units.

Formula

drams per milliliter = short tons per cubic yard × 0.669670717089

This factor comes from each unit's defined relationship to the category's base unit: 1 short ton per cubic yard equals 1186.55284252 base units, and 1 dram per milliliter equals 1771.84519531 base units, so dividing one by the other gives the direct short ton per cubic yard-to-dram per milliliter factor of 0.669670717089.

What's the difference between density and mass concentration?

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
